Web8. apr 2024 · The lingual surface refers to the tongue-side of your teeth and is also generally smooth. The exception to this is the upper molars that may also have lingual grooves that end in a pit. Some of your upper front teeth may also have some lingual pits. Occlusal and Incisal Surfaces These surfaces are typically present on the biting side of your teeth. Weblingual surface of tooth: [TA] the oral surface of a mandibular tooth that faces the tongue, opposite to its vestibular surface. Synonym(s): facies lingualis dentis [TA]

Web12. sep 2024 · On the lingual of all anterior teeth, a cingulum [SING gyoo lum] (plural cingula) is the prominence or bulge in the cervical third of the lingual surface of the crown (incisors and canines) (seen on the lingual view in Fig. 1-29 and seen as a prominence in the cervical third of the crown on the proximal view in Fig. 1-30).
